Construction Scheduler

The Construction Scheduler will work within the Scheduling department and will report to the Scheduling Manager. Utilizing their ability to make sense of large quantities of complex data, the Scheduler will work closely with the Project Managers and Project Superintendents to input schedule status updates, incorporate logic changes and delays, and analyze project schedule progress. To support a collaborative, and team-focused environment, the construction scheduler will be based fully in person at the project site near Amarillo, TX.

Salary Range: $100,000 to $130,000 DOE + Incentives & per diem

Essential Responsibilities:

  • Collect and input schedule status update information into the record project schedule.
  • Attend project schedule progress meetings as needed.
  • Identify changes to the project schedule.
  • Notify teams of impacts to critical path activities and/or schedule logic.
  • Ensure technical schedule integrity is maintained.
  • Produce and distribute weekly and monthly schedules, forecasts, and reports.
  • Manage Outlook distribution lists and standard form emails for schedule distribution.
  • Maintain project schedule archives and documentation.
